Specifications
Series: CSM-7
Packaging: Tape & Reel (TR) 
Part Status: Active
Type: MHz Crystal
Frequency: 48MHz
Frequency Stability: ±50ppm
Frequency Tolerance: ±30ppm
Load Capacitance: 20pF
ESR (Equivalent Series Resistance): 80 Ohms
Operating Mode: 3rd Overtone
Operating Temperature: -10°C ~ 70°C
Ratings: --
Mounting Type: Surface Mount
Package / Case: HC-49/US
Size / Dimension: 0.449" L x 0.189" W (11.40mm x 4.80mm)
Height - Seated (Max): 0.169" (4.30mm)

Working Principle

ECS-480-20-5P-TR is a quartz crystal oscillator. This type of oscillator is based on piezoelectric effect in a quartz crystal. When an electric field is applied to the quartz crystal, it deforms very slightly. This creates an elastic force and generates a voltage, which is known as the piezoelectric effect.

This voltage can then be used to oscillate the crystal at a constant frequency, which is determined by its physical characteristics. This frequency is dependent on the size and shape of the crystal, as well as its temperature. The crystal is placed in a sealed container, and its frequency is adjusted by applying a voltage to a tuning screw.

When the oscillator is placed in a circuit, the output of the oscillator will be a sinusoidal wave. This wave can be used to control the timing of other electronic components in the same circuit. This is what makes the ECS-480-20-5P-TR such a useful component.
